#d1ce5c basic color information

#d1ce5c

In the RGB color model, hex triplet #d1ce5c has decimal index of: 13749852, is composed of 82% red, 80.8% green and 36.1% blue. #d1ce5c in CMYK color model, is composed of 0% cyan, 1.4% magenta, 56% yellow and 18% black.
#cccc66 is the closest web-safe color to #d1ce5c.

Analogous colors

They are colors that are next to each other on the color wheel. Analogous colors tend to look pleasant together, because they are closely related.

Monochromatic

Shades are created by decreasing luminance in HSL color model, and tints by increasing it. The next step for shades is #000 and for tints is #fff.
